Milkshake is a mobile-first website builder that lets you create a free "Milkshake website" directly from your phone. It uses a swipeable card format (similar to Instagram Stories) to present your links and content. Milkshake does not offer in-app browser bypass.

For content creators who need in-app browser bypass: NullMark is purpose-built for this exact problem. It forces Instagram, TikTok, and Facebook links to open in Safari or Chrome, restoring payments, logins, and tracking.

Milkshake is a mobile website builder with a swipeable format. NullMark is a browser bypass tool. Use NullMark to open the real browser, then redirect to your Milkshake site.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does Milkshake bypass in-app browsers?
No. Milkshake sites open inside in-app browsers. NullMark can be used in front of your Milkshake site for browser bypass.
Is Milkshake really free?
Yes. Milkshake is free to use and can be built entirely from your phone. It is ad-supported on the free tier.
